Physicians, Pathologists in New York-Newark-Jersey City, NY-NJ

Employers filed 11 applications covering 11 positions for this role here, at a median of $299,489 a year. 9 of those state a minimum and no maximum — a Labor Condition Application commits an employer to a floor, not to a salary.

What the government requires here

The prevailing wage for Physicians, Pathologists in New York-Newark-Jersey City, NY-NJ, wage year 2025-26 — the four levels an employer must meet depending on the experience the role demands.

LevelWho it is forA year
Level IEntry: a role needing basic understanding and close supervision$90,293
Level IIQualified: some experience, moderate supervision$161,034
Level IIIExperienced: sound understanding, limited supervision$231,795
Level IVFully competent: judgement, may supervise others$302,536
